U-Pb LA-ICPMS and SHRIMP zircon geochronology data from the Bidahochi basin and surrounding areas, northern Arizona
March 5, 2026
This dataset consists of eight sandstone samples and four ash samples collected from the Bidahochi basin that were analyzed for U-Pb zircon ages. The dataset accompanies the publication "Late Miocene Colorado River arrival in Bidahochi basin permits spillover origin of Grand Canyon". Samples were collected from the field by Ryan Crow (USGS) and John Douglass (Paradise Valley Community College faculty) in 2024 and analyzed at the USGS G3 Plasma Lab, the University of Arizona Laserchron Center, and at the Stanford-USGS SHRIMP-RG ion microprobe housed at Stanford University in 2025.
